What you will do:
The Senior Accountant will be responsible for the monthly preparation of financial statements by applying GAAP and Company accounting policies for assigned practices. This individual will analyze financial statement trends and variances and effectively communicate business drivers of the variances.
- Directly responsible for financial statement close cycle; to include preparation of GAAP and management reports of designated practices within 5-business days.
- Perform timely and accurate account reconciliations for the entire business.
- Responsible for all balance sheet reconciliations for the entire platform.
- Provides practice monthly financial analysis and works closely with practice management on:
- Departmental expense review with fluctuation analysis
- Revenue cycle review with fluctuation analysis
- Segment profitability with fluctuation analysis
- Support Pro Forma development for organic and capex initiatives.
- Support annual budget process.
- Prepare and maintain fixed asset depreciation schedule by various categories according to company policy.
- Calculate and analyze quarterly Physician compensation bonuses; and provide detailed supporting schedules for all components within the calculation.
- Labor analysis.
- Ensures compliance with applicable federal, state, local and audit requirements.
- All other duties as assigned.
What you bring to the table:
- Bachelor's degree in Business, preferred concentration in Accounting or finance required, preferably within the healthcare industry.
- CPA preferred.
- 3 years of accounting/finance experience; directly involved in financial close cycle.
- Excellent Excel skills, including Pivot Tables, V-Lookups and advanced formulas.
- Working knowledge of financial systems, such as Sage Intacct or NetSuite
- Working knowledge of business intelligence/reports software, such as PowerBI or Tableau.
- Working knowledge of 3rd party payroll processing system, preferably Paylocity.
- Proven experience with general ledger functions and the month-end/year-end close process required.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, experience working in diverse environments.
